My configuration file includes alternative entries for different provers. When I execute why3 prove with that prover, then the output of why3 is a message informing that I have more than one prover in my configuration file with the given name, the list of these provers.
/home/xyz> why3 prove --prover Z3 afile.why
More than one prover in /home/xyz/.why3.conf correspond to "Z3":
Z3 (4.4.1), Z3 (4.4.1 noBV)
I would like to know how to call why3 on a specific alternative of that prover, if this is possible.
Eventually I peeked at the source code of Why3 to get an answer. It is to be found in why3/src/driver/whyconf.mli and why3/src/driver/whyconf.ml.
A solution is to use the version and alternative fields of the prover entry in Why3's configuration file. For instance, if this file contains the following two entries for Z3:
The "alternative" field differs between entries. So to call the first entry, the command is:
To call the second entry, the command is:
